## Authentication

Plugin authors extending the Fernscript rendering pipeline must authenticate before submitting markdown transform manifests. The sandbox validates each request against your registered plugin scope; unsigned transforms are rejected before the parse stage. All calls to the pipeline API require an Authorization header. For sandbox testing, use the shared evaluation token provided below.

portal login ticket: eyJhbGciOiJIUzI1NiIsInR5cCI6IkpXVCJ9.eyJzdWIiOiIwEOsktwVNwIn0.-UJU3fdyyCgG

**Handover: timezone handling in ReportForge exports**

Hi — quick brain dump before I rotate off. ReportForge exports normalize everything to UTC internally, but plugin authors keep assuming local time, which is why the Dawnmere team saw off-by-a-day rows. Your plugin should read the export timezone from config, never from the host machine. Also note that DST shifts are applied at render time, not query time. The timezone-related settings your plugin will receive are the following.

config for kafof-bawef:
holath:
  log_level: debug
  metrics_host: metrics.holath.qorvelsys.internal
  pin: 2191
  pool_size: 32

RETIREMENT: Bramblewick Product Line (Managers Only)

The Bramblewick analytics suite will be retired at the end of Q3. Sales leads should stop quoting new Bramblewick licences immediately and steer prospects toward Fenholt Insights. Existing customers retain support for twelve months under the standard sunset policy. Migration collateral is available on the Tarnmoor wiki space. Do not announce externally until the launch team confirms. Strategic context follows in the confidential note below.

confidential, kagep-kahof: Druokax Systems plans to lower the Ulaath list price by 53 percent in March.

// Fixture: fd-leak hunt in the Pellwick ingest worker.
// Context: after ~4h uptime the worker exhausts descriptors.
// This fixture spins up 200 fake upload sessions against the
// mock Brindlehost endpoint and asserts the open-fd count
// returns to baseline after teardown. If it doesn't, check
// the retry path in fetch_chunk() — it clones the socket.
// Run with ulimit -n 256 to fail fast.
// The mock endpoint expects the auth header below.

login token, bagug-kafop: eyJhbGciOiJIUzI1NiIsInR5cCI6IkpXVCJ9.eyJzdWIiOiIcMLov2In0.Z5RLDIfp